安装 rpy2 时遇到错误:尝试猜测 R 的 HOME 但在 PATH 中没有 R 命令



我在这里和其他地方看到了很多有关此错误的帖子,但是提出的解决方案似乎没有相关。我在Python 2.7.9上,我的路径上有一个R可执行文件,并且我试图在不在Windows上的RHEL服务器上安装它。

这是我看到的具体错误。有人知道会导致它或如何修复它吗?谢谢!

$ pip install rpy2
Downloading/unpacking rpy2
  Downloading rpy2-2.5.6.tar.gz (165kB): 165kB downloaded
  Running setup.py (path:/tmp/pip_build_my520/rpy2/setup.py) egg_info for package rpy2
    Error: Tried to guess R's HOME but no R command in the PATH.
    Complete output from command python setup.py egg_info:
    Error: Tried to guess R's HOME but no R command in the PATH.

从Christoph Gohlke的Python扩展程序包中的Windows存储库中下载rpy2‑2.7.5‑cp35‑none‑win_amd64.whl文件。使用命令行,更改为下载文件夹并运行:

pip install rpy2‑2.5.5‑cp34‑none‑win_amd64.whl

这应该解决r目录问题,RPY2应安装得很好。所有归功于Mattdmo。

较低版本rpy2中可用的此问题。在安装以下版本之后,已解决。

rpy2==3.4.2

相关内容

最新更新